What are the body dimensions of the Reiz?

The body dimensions of the Reiz are: length 4750mm, width 1795mm, height 1450mm. It belongs to a mid-size car with a wheelbase of 2850mm, a fuel tank capacity of 70 liters, and a trunk capacity of 480 liters. The tire specification is 215/60R16. The Reiz is equipped with a 2.5L naturally aspirated engine, delivering a maximum power of 142kW at 6200rpm and a maximum torque of 236Nm. It is paired with a 6-speed automatic transmission and features a double-wishbone front suspension, multi-link independent rear suspension, and xenon headlights.

The dimensions of the Reiz (Mark X) are generally about 4785 mm in length, 1795 mm in width, and 1455 mm in height, with a wheelbase reaching 2850 mm. I've been driving the Reiz for several years and feel these dimensions are particularly well-suited for sporty driving. The moderate body length combined with the long wheelbase ensures stability at high speeds, while the rear-wheel-drive layout enhances handling during corners. The width is kept at 1795 mm, making it easy to navigate urban roads without being too wide, and the small turning radius allows for effortless maneuvering in busy areas. However, the relatively low height of 1455 mm gives it a coupe-like feel, which might result in slightly tight headroom for taller passengers, but the overall compact design boosts driving pleasure. The dimensions also influence weight distribution, with the rear-wheel-drive ensuring a balanced center of gravity for smooth driving. Parking isn’t an issue either, as the length stays under 4.8 meters, fitting comfortably in garages or roadside spots. In short, the Reiz's dimensions are intelligently designed, striking a perfect balance between performance and everyday practicality, which is a big plus for driving enthusiasts like me.

What are the length, width, and height of the Lingpai?

The length, width, and height of the Lingpai are 4756mm, 1804mm, and 1509mm respectively, with a front track of 1500mm, rear track of 1485mm, and a wheelbase of 2730mm. The Lingpai is a compact mid-size sedan under GAC Honda, equipped with a 1.0T three-cylinder turbocharged engine that delivers a maximum power of 90kW and a maximum torque of 173Nm. In terms of the transmission system, the car is paired with a CVT continuously variable transmission and a 6-speed manual transmission. The front suspension features a MacPherson independent suspension, while the rear suspension uses a torsion beam non-independent suspension.

What is the Function of a Central Differential Lock?

The function of a central differential lock: It can enhance the vehicle's off-road capability on poor road surfaces. When one of the vehicle's drive axles spins freely, it can quickly lock the differential, turning the two drive axles into a rigid connection. This allows most of the torque to be transferred to the non-slipping drive axle, fully utilizing the traction to generate sufficient driving force, enabling the vehicle to continue moving. The central differential lock, also known as the central differential locker, is a locking mechanism installed on the central differential, used in four-wheel-drive vehicles. Different differentials employ various locking methods. Common differential locks include the following types: forced locking, high-friction self-locking, jaw coupling, Torsen, and viscous coupling.

What is the working principle of the intake pressure sensor?

The working principle of the intake pressure sensor: It detects the changes in the absolute pressure in the intake manifold based on the engine speed and load, then converts it into a signal voltage and sends it to the engine control unit. The engine control unit uses this signal voltage to determine the basic fuel injection quantity. There are various types of intake pressure sensors, including piezoresistive and capacitive types. Due to its fast response time, high detection accuracy, small size, and flexible installation, the piezoresistive type is widely used in D-type injection systems. The pressure sensor measures pressure using a pressure chip, which is the core component of the sensor.

Where is the fuel filler switch for the Audi A6?

The Audi A6 does not have a dedicated fuel filler switch. After turning off the vehicle, you need to press the fuel tank cap to open it. The fuel tank cap switch is located under the driver's door and is integrated with the front engine compartment switch. Pressing this electronic switch will open the fuel tank cap cover. The Audi A6 has body dimensions of 4886mm in length, 1810mm in width, and 1475m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2850mm. The vehicle is equipped with a 5-speed manual transmission and features such as ABS anti-lock braking, brake force distribution, engine electronic immobilizer, remote key, central locking, in-car CD player, and auto-dimming rearview mirror. The front suspension is a multi-link independent suspension, while the rear suspension is a longitudinal trailing arm torsion beam suspension.

How many kilometers do winter tires need to be replaced?

Winter tires need to be replaced after driving 50,000 to 60,000 kilometers, and the specific situation should be judged according to the degree of tire damage. The tread material of winter tires is softer, and the silica-mixed rubber compound can contact the smooth ice surface more closely, generating greater friction than all-season tires, improving the vehicle's handling and safety on smooth ice surfaces. Winter tires are specifically designed for winter conditions, such as snowy and icy climates and areas with lower temperatures. Their tread patterns usually use cross-Z-shaped siping technology, which can improve braking performance on snow and ice, shorten braking distances, and provide ideal traction.
